Veneto Unveiled: A Journey Through Italy's Region of Wonders
Veneto, a tapestry woven with the threads of history, culture, and natural splendor, stretches from the Dolomites' snowy peaks to the Adriatic Sea's lapping waves. This northeastern region of Italy is a mosaic of breathtaking landscapes, ancient cities, and culinary delights, beckoning travelers to uncover its many treasures.
Venice, the jewel in Veneto's crown, is a city that defies the ordinary. Floating on its lagoon, it's a place of dreamlike beauty, with gondolas gliding silently under ancient bridges, and majestic palazzi reflecting in the shimmering waters. St. Mark's Square, with the Byzantine majesty of St. Mark's Basilica, offers a spectacle of architectural grandeur, while the Rialto Bridge presents a bustling tableau of Venetian life.
Beyond the allure of Venice lies Verona, a city immortalized by Shakespeare's tale of star-crossed lovers. Here, the ancient Roman Arena, still resonant with the echoes of gladiatorial combat, hosts open-air operas under the stars. The balcony of Juliet's house offers a moment of romance, while the city's vibrant piazzas and medieval architecture invite leisurely exploration.
The Dolomites, a UNESCO World Heritage site, offer a dramatic contrast with their rugged peaks and serene alpine meadows. Whether it's the adrenaline rush of skiing in Cortina d'Ampezzo or the tranquil beauty of a hike around the Tre Cime di Lavaredo, the mountains are a haven for adventurers and nature lovers alike.
Lake Garda, Italy's largest lake, is a serene oasis that has inspired poets and artists for centuries. The northern shores are embraced by mountains, offering dramatic scenery and charming towns like Riva del Garda, while the southern shores are dotted with sandy beaches and bustling resorts like Sirmione, known for its thermal baths and the Scaliger Castle.
Valpolicella, a region synonymous with wine, offers rolling vineyards and ancient villas. A tour through its wineries reveals the secrets behind Amarone, the region’s famed wine, offering a taste of Veneto’s rich culinary heritage.
The Palladian villas of Vicenza showcase the genius of Andrea Palladio, whose architectural principles shaped Western design. These elegant country homes, set against the verdant countryside, offer a glimpse into the refined lifestyle of the Venetian nobility.
